Отключите вывод в диалог и посмотрите будет ли вылет.
Ну и код диалога скиньте.
11. Zireael - 13 Ноября, 2018 - 17:45:53 - перейти к сообщению
12. ivantu - 13 Ноября, 2018 - 23:40:31 - перейти к сообщению
Диалог минимальный,
чтоб отключить вывод в диалог, я так понял нужно закомментировать просто эту часть кода? Если так, то вылетов не наблюдается.
CODE:
int pos_size_static0[1][4];
string text_static0[1];
pos_size_static0[0][0]=20; pos_size_static0[0][1]=21; pos_size_static0[0][2]=200; pos_size_static0[0][3]=336;
text_static0[0]="";
//////////
createdialog(1, STATIC, #pos_size_static0[0][0], #text_static0[0]);
//////////
showdialog(0, "Последние действия", 526, 218, 250, 400, 0, 1);
//////////
int pos_size_static0[1][4];
string text_static0[1];
pos_size_static0[0][0]=20; pos_size_static0[0][1]=21; pos_size_static0[0][2]=200; pos_size_static0[0][3]=336;
text_static0[0]="";
//////////
createdialog(1, STATIC, #pos_size_static0[0][0], #text_static0[0]);
//////////
showdialog(0, "Последние действия", 526, 218, 250, 400, 0, 1);
//////////
чтоб отключить вывод в диалог, я так понял нужно закомментировать просто эту часть кода? Если так, то вылетов не наблюдается.
CODE:
//LOGS
/*
function add_string(string temp)
{
log_z++; s=s+temp+rn;
if(log_z>max_string) // если достигнут максимум строк в логе
{
regexsearch(1, #s, s, "(?<=\r\n).*", SINGLELINE);
}
return s;
}
*/
//LOGS
/*
function add_string(string temp)
{
log_z++; s=s+temp+rn;
if(log_z>max_string) // если достигнут максимум строк в логе
{
regexsearch(1, #s, s, "(?<=\r\n).*", SINGLELINE);
}
return s;
}
*/
13. Zireael - 14 Ноября, 2018 - 03:05:29 - перейти к сообщению
Цитата:
я так понял нужно закомментировать просто эту часть кода?
Вообще-то надо было закомментировать строки, в которых вызывается функция.
Цитата:
createdialog(1
showdialog(0
showdialog(0
Тогда уж showdialog(1
Цитата:
Если так, то вылетов не наблюдается.
В чём проблема может быть не знаю. Сама функция работает, дело не в ней.
code (Отобразить)
14. ivantu - 14 Ноября, 2018 - 04:25:52 - перейти к сообщению
Вы правы, спасибо, действительно работает, а в моем случае не совсем... ладно может как то вылетит на ружу тот косяк
Спасибо еще раз огромное, у меня еще вопросик не большой, подскажите пожалуйста, а есть ли возможность перед тем как выводить надпись в лог проверять не совподает ли она с последней записью, если да то не добавлять, а то иногда пишет в лог по два три раза одно и тоже... была бы полезная фишка.
Спасибо еще раз огромное, у меня еще вопросик не большой, подскажите пожалуйста, а есть ли возможность перед тем как выводить надпись в лог проверять не совподает ли она с последней записью, если да то не добавлять, а то иногда пишет в лог по два три раза одно и тоже... была бы полезная фишка.
15. GGman - 14 Ноября, 2018 - 05:02:03 - перейти к сообщению
ivantu , у меня тоже часто логи по 2 раза. Это явно какая-то ошибка в киборе
16. ivantu - 14 Ноября, 2018 - 05:22:16 - перейти к сообщению
GGman пишет:
у меня тоже часто логи по 2 раза. Это явно какая-то ошибка в киборе
я так не думаю... нужна просто дороботка
17. Kibor - 14 Ноября, 2018 - 05:26:24 - перейти к сообщению
GGman пишет:
Это явно какая-то ошибка в киборе
Не, не.. Это явная ошибка в среде разработки, в которой я написал Кибор.
Короче стрелки я первел. Теперь это их проблема.
18. ivantu - 14 Ноября, 2018 - 05:36:37 - перейти к сообщению
Цитата:
подскажите пожалуйста, а есть ли возможность перед тем как выводить надпись в лог проверять не совподает ли она с последней записью, если да то не добавлять, а то иногда пишет в лог по два три раза одно и тоже... была бы полезная фишка.
19. Zireael - 14 Ноября, 2018 - 05:47:57 - перейти к сообщению
Цитата:
подскажите пожалуйста, а есть ли возможность перед тем как выводить надпись в лог проверять не совподает ли она с последней записью, если да то не добавлять, а то иногда пишет в лог по два три раза одно и тоже... была бы полезная фишка.
code (Отобразить)
20. ivantu - 14 Ноября, 2018 - 05:53:44 - перейти к сообщению
Zireael Низкий поклон Вам, то что доктор прописал!